A stain on a dormer ceiling almost never starts at the window. It usually starts at the apron flashing, the cheek-to-roof soaker, the back gutter or a split in the flat roof covering, and travels. We trace the actual water path before quoting, because replacing a window that was never leaking is the most common wasted spend on a dormer.

Planning and building control in Dumfries and Galloway
We run the permitted development test on your specific property: set-back from the eaves, height against the ridge, volume allowance and whether an Article 4 direction applies locally.
Building regulations approval is separate and always required. We submit the application, book the inspections around the programme and hand you the completion certificate at the end — the document a buyer's surveyor will ask to see.

Can you build a dormer in winter?
Yes, with adjustments. Temporary weather protection over the scaffold lets structural work continue in most conditions. GRP roofing needs dry conditions above about 5°C to cure properly, so in a cold spell we either sequence it differently or specify EPDM, which is unaffected.
How much does a dormer window cost?
A single flat roof dormer typically runs from around £9,000 to £20,000 supplied and fitted, depending on width, cladding finish and access. A full-width rear dormer on a semi is usually £28,000 to £45,000, and a complete dormer loft conversion including stairs, insulation, plaster and building control sign-off is more commonly £40,000 to £70,000. Does a dormer need building regulations approval?
Yes, always — permitted development covers planning, not building control. A dormer needs approval for structure, thermal performance under Part L, fire escape and protected route under Part B, and stairs under Part K if a staircase is involved. Why is my dormer leaking?
In our experience the window itself is the cause less than a fifth of the time. Far more often it is the apron flashing at the dormer front, the lead soakers where the cheeks meet the roof slope, the back gutter behind a pitched dormer, or a split at an upstand in the flat covering. Water then tracks along a rafter and appears somewhere else entirely, which is why we trace the path before quoting.
Will a dormer add value to my house?
A properly built and signed-off dormer conversion adding a bedroom and bathroom typically returns a meaningful share of its cost in value, and more in areas where floor space is scarce. The building control completion certificate is what makes the space count as habitable floor area on a valuation — without it, surveyors will not include it.
